If you look at the crossmember in front of the motor, there should be some oval-shaped holes at either end and the build sheet may be visible through one of them. If you can see it, it might be removable but you will need some long needle-nose pliers to carefully roll the sheet into a very small coil and thread it through the hole.

The best way to get one is to buy it fron the National Corvette Museum.

On my '95 a build sheet was on the passenger side top & rear of the gas tank. It was stuck under the radio ground plane and the tank mounting strap but I got most of it via the hole under the license tag. The missing part was about 1"X 4" from the sheet's lower right corner so the VIN, dealer destination and all the codes were on the retrieved pieces. The paper was very fragile so it tore some. It was also very dirty but it's nice to have the actual sheet.
